can anyone tell me what this is, I thought it was candycane but it is all one color. We thought it was dead coral when we got the tank and after 1 mth of being used to prop another coral up, low and behold these decided to grace us with thier beauty.

It's the same as the brown/green ones. It's a Caulastrea furcata. Here is a picture of mine from about a year ago (it's a bit larger now but the color of this pictures is better). It is a very fast grower.
